HIV Care Coordinator: Manages care plans for adolescents living with HIV, ensuring access to medical and social support services.
Adolescent Health Specialist: Focuses on the unique health needs of adolescents, providing tailored care and education.
Social Care Worker: Offers emotional and practical support to adolescents and their families, addressing social challenges.
Community Health Educator: Delivers HIV awareness programs and promotes healthy behaviors among adolescents.
Clinical Support Worker: Assists healthcare professionals in delivering clinical care to adolescents living with HIV.
